The experts/parts suppliers for these are American Diesel Corp,effectively the Lehman successors,owners previously associated with Lehman.
FLs came in 80 and 120, later the "Super"version came as 90 and 135 hp.
I have twin 120s in a 36ft, I think it would be ok with twin 90s, plenty came with a single 120. They were fitted to some IG32s, maybe GBs too.
Cheap on fuel, easy to service, parts available, no electronics, no turbo,simple agricultural type engines, certainly not a failed trial engine.
Some of the 80s used raw water as coolant, ie no heat exchanger system. I`d avoid them.

Greetings,
Mr. O. I think what Mr. BK is alluding to regarding "oil changes" is oil changes in the injector pump. The regular 90's and 120's have a stand alone oil reservoir that is the injector pump body, itself. Where engine oil changes are every 100 hours, injector oil changes are recommended, by some, to be every 50 hours.

The "super" series, as I understand it, have injector pumps that are lubed by the engine oil and are taken care of by regular engine oil changes.

I attended a lecture by the late Bob Smith (the ultimate guru of Lehman engines) and I remember him saying that one could change the injector oil at the same time as an engine oil change (every 100 hours). He said the manual recommendation of a 50 hour injector pump change was a misprint.

Edit: I think the 50 hour injector oil change was as a result of potential oil dilution by leaky internals in the pump itself as the pump aged. Our former Lehman showed evidence of this leakage. Upon draining there was a quite distinct odor of diesel. So I did do a 50 hour change on that pump.



Our current twin Lehman 120's have no evidence of diesel odor so I adhere to the 100 hour regime.

How much you'll gain from shutting down an engine depends a lot on the boat. Depending on whether you can let your transmissions freewheel or not will impact drag (a locked prop is more drag than a freewheeling one). There's also some drag from having the rudders off-center while running on one.

Different engines will have different efficiency curves. A lot of diesels don't drop off too badly at light load, so shutting one down may save a little fuel, but not a lot. But a gas engine has horrible light load efficiency, so the gain from shutting one down and increasing load on the other is likely to be better.

Of course, there are also any electrical system concerns to be aware of as well as potential boat handling issues.

Now if you had a way to drive both props from one or both engines (like a diesel electric setup), you'd be onto something. Run 1 engine with full maneuverability, etc. until you need more power, then start up the second one.

With a displacement hull and many semi displacement hulls, there is pretty much a fixed horsepower required to get the boat to do hull speed. The amount of fuel required to produce that horsepower does not vary very much at all from engine to engine, especially the old clam-crushers most of us have. One engine producing 50 hp or two producing 25 or 30 each is approximately the same fuel burn.

I don’t think they necessarily give you longer time between oil changes. But one significant difference between the 80-120(Dorset) and 90-135 (Dover) engines is on the Dover based engines the oil supply to the all important fuel injector pump is shared with the engine. rather than having its own reservoir that must be changed at typically no more than 100 hr intervals. The main engine oil is specd at 200 hr change interval.

I took the last seminar that Bob Smith gave. He said change the injector oil at 50 hours. If it was not diluted then extend the interval a bit more. When you started to see dilution then you have gone too far in hours. He said that frequently engines are different. One member in the class said with his twin engine boat one engine needed an oil change at 50 hours and his other engine would go 100 hours.

I have twin P90's. Simple and reliable. Easy to work on, parts readily available. As previously mentioned they are an upgrade from the Std 80 with the addition of an improved injection pump.

I have used 1 engine to get home out of necessity. Slight drag from unused prop. I consider normal maintenance and fuel costs to be a very small part of boat ownership. There are several prior threads regarding singles v. twins. I think the overall condition of the boat and the engines is more important than the number of engines. Find the boat you like. Buy it.
 
I have twin 90’s in my Krogen 42, one of five out of two hundred plus made. I cruise at 7.5 mph @ 1400 rpm burning 1.9 gph. If I run on one engine I lose 2 mph. It’s a #43,000 Vessel.
